+/*****************************************************************************
+ * *
+ * B l u e M o o n *
+ * ================= *
+ * V2.2 *
+ * A patience game by T.A.Lister *
+ * Integral screen support by Eric S. Raymond *
+ * *
+ *****************************************************************************/
+
+/*
+ * Compile this with the command `cc -O blue.c -lcurses -o blue'. For best
+ * results, use the ncurses(3) library. On non-Intel machines, SVr4 curses is
+ * just as good.
+ *
+ * $Id: blue.c,v 1.33 2009/10/24 21:03:35 tom Exp $
+ */

+static void
+display_cards(int deal)
+{
+ int row, card;
+
+ clear();
+ (void) printw(
+ "Blue Moon 2.1 - by Tim Lister & Eric Raymond - Deal %d.\n",
+ deal);
+ for (row = HEARTS; row <= CLUBS; row++) {
+ move(BASEROW + row + row + 2, 1);
+ for (card = 0; card < GRID_WIDTH; card++)
+ printcard(grid[row * GRID_WIDTH + card]);
+ }
+
+ move(PROMPTROW + 2, 0);
+ refresh();
+#define P(x) (void)printw("%s\n", x)
+ P(" This 52-card solitaire starts with the entire deck shuffled and dealt");
+ P("out in four rows. The aces are then moved to the left end of the layout,");
+ P("making 4 initial free spaces. You may move to a space only the card that");
+ P("matches the left neighbor in suit, and is one greater in rank. Kings are");
+ P("high, so no cards may be placed to their right (they create dead spaces).");
+ P(" When no moves can be made, cards still out of sequence are reshuffled");
+ P("and dealt face up after the ends of the partial sequences, leaving a card");
+ P("space after each sequence, so that each row looks like a partial sequence");
+ P("followed by a space, followed by enough cards to make a row of 14. ");
+ P(" A moment's reflection will show that this game cannot take more than 13");
+ P("deals. A good score is 1-3 deals, 4-7 is average, 8 or more is poor. ");
+#undef P
+ refresh();
+}
